Ping 命令可以帮助我们检查域名是否正确解析到对应的 IP 地址。运行 ping example.com
命令,可以看到域名解析的 IP 地址。IP 地址与预期不符,则说明域名解析存在问题。
Nslookup 命令则可以查看域名的 DNS 解析记录。运行 nslookup example.com
命令,可以看到域名对应的 A 记录、CNAME 记录等信息。通过分析这些信息,我们可以判断域名解析是否正确。
有时我们需要将域名解析到不同的 IP 地址,例如实现负载均衡或故障转移。这可以通过动态 DNS 服务来实现。动态 DNS 服务允许我们编程设置域名解析规则,根据访问者的位置、时间等因素自动解析到合适的 IP 地址。
常见的动态 DNS 服务有 DynDNS、No-IP 等。我们可以在这些服务中设置解析规则,例如按照访问者的地理位置解析到就近的服务器 IP 地址。编写自动化脚本,定期更新域名解析记录,即可实现自动域名解析的功能。